A designer will form a close partnership with a user researcher and often a front end developer and a business analyst, for a given digital service. They put together just enough of a prototype to help the wider team learn about user needs for a given scenario or task.
This could take the form of a rough sketch, a diagram, an interactive mock up or a coded prototype. They will iterate prototypes based on research with users to validate or invalidate design assumptions, moving to working with real code as early as possible.
This role is about challenging assumptions and testing ideas. Rather than make things look ‘pretty’ or design what a stakeholder thinks they need, we’re here to translate known user needs in to a solution that we think meets those needs, and then to test how well those needs have been met.
This insight is then fed in to a current sprint, or in to the product backlog for later. Designers are expected to use existing government visual design style guides and design patterns, where these have already been tested and validated for similar domains and users.
